What is the probability of the dice toss?

Out of the 36 possible outcomes for a pair of six-sided dice with faces numbered 1–6, the possible totals are between 2 and 12 and they include;

2: 1

3: 2

4: 3

5: 4

6: 5

7: 6

8: 5

9: 4

10: 3

11: 2

12: 1

From the list above, it is clear that a roll of ‘at least 3’ will occur with a probability of 35 times out of 36.

Meanwhile, a roll of ‘at least 6’ will occur with a probability of 26 times out of 36.

Thus, the probability that the first roll is a total of at least 3 and the second roll is a total of at least 6 = (35/36) * (26/36) = 455/648 = 70.2%
